Why create_palette is rated Medium
The tool creates or generates new palette and gradient data that modifies the project state reversibly. This is not destructive (can be undone/deleted), does not execute arbitrary code, does not involve financial transactions, and does not merely read existing data. Creating visual assets in TouchDesigner qualifies as a Write operation.
From the tool's definition Tool description states 'Generate a reusable colour palette + gradient' — this creates new data (palette/gradient assets) that persists in the TouchDesigner project and can be bound by other tools.

create_palette is a Write tool with medium risk. Write tools should be rate-limited to prevent accidental bulk modifications.
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the create_palette r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.
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for create_palette.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
